2.4 提高程序可读性的技巧:
1.使用合理的变量名
(例如用:int width
而不是 int islfjjdl
…)
2.养成多写注释的习惯!多写注释!写注释!
(便于自己/别人看)
3.在函数中用空行划分不同概念的多个部分
(多空行看着比较舒服/更清晰)
4.每条语句独占一行
(同看着舒服/清晰)
5.每条语句结束后加分号
(;
)
示例:
#include <stdio.h>
int main( void )
{
int four;
four = 4;
printf( "%d\n", four);
return 0;
}
进阶示例:
程序清单2.2 fathm_ft.c程序
// fathm_ft.c -- 把2音寻转换成英寸
#include <stdio.h>
int main(void)
{
int feet, fathoms
fathoms = 2;
feet = 6 * fathoms;
printf("There are %d feet in %d fathoms!\n", feet, fathoms);
printf("Yes, I said %d feet!\n", 6 * fathoms);
return 0;
}
关于多条声明:
int A , B;
与
int A;
int B;
完全等价
关于乘法:
1.用 *
表示“乘以”
2.feet = 6 * fathoms
表示:查找 fathoms 的值,用 6 乘以 fathoms 的值,并将其值赋给 feet
关于%d:
printf("There are %d feet in %d fathoms!\n", feet, fathoms);
“一一对应”
第一个%d对应 引号外 第一个变量,即 feet
第二个%d对应 引号外 第二个变量,即 fathoms